What type of wood is recommended for crafting a personalized charcuterie board?

When crafting a personalized charcuterie board, the choice of wood is crucial for both aesthetic appeal and functionality. Hardwoods are highly recommended due to their durability and resistance to wear. Popular choices include:

  • Maple: Known for its fine, uniform grain and light color, maple is a sturdy option that resists warping and is easy to clean.
  • Walnut: This darker wood adds an elegant touch with its rich colors and patterns. Walnut is also durable and provides a good surface for cutting.
  • Bamboo: While technically a grass, bamboo is a sustainable choice that is both lightweight and durable. It has natural antibacterial properties, making it a hygienic option.
  • Cherry: Cherry wood ages beautifully, developing a deep, rich color over time. It’s strong yet lightweight, making it ideal for a charcuterie board.
  • Teak: Known for its water resistance and natural oils, teak is excellent for serving food and resists damage from moisture.

Regardless of the type chosen, ensure that the wood is food-safe and properly treated with mineral oil or a food-safe finish to enhance its longevity.
